Regular Council Meeting Highlights for February 28, 2022

Posted on Tuesday, March 01, 2022 11:59 AM

Councillor Harold Pawlechko Sworn in as Deputy Mayor

Councillor Harold Pawlechko was appointed Deputy Chief Elected Official during last night’s meeting. As per the Municipal Government Act, each Councillor serves as Deputy Chief Elected Official (Deputy Mayor) twice within their Council term. Councillor Pawlechko will serve as Deputy Mayor from February 28 to June 30, or until the appointment of the next Deputy.

Become a Local Expert with the New Tourism Ambassador Program

Posted on Wednesday, February 16, 2022 09:00 AM

A new tourism program is coming to town. Stony Plain businesses are invited to become ‘Tourism Ambassadors’ by participating in a collaborative training program with the Town of Stony Plain and the Greater Parkland Regional Chamber of Commerce.

Regular Council Meeting Highlights for February 14, 2022

Posted on Tuesday, February 15, 2022 02:18 PM

Update Proposed for Land Use Bylaw to Prepare for New Housing Strategy

First reading was given to a proposed repeal and update of the Land Use Bylaw at last night’s meeting. The update follows the introduction of the Town’s first Housing Strategy, a guiding document that outlines approaches to meeting housing goals and informs land use and development divisions. The bylaw update aims to solidify an annual administrative update that will ensure the bylaw remains current.

Community Volunteer Income Tax Program Provides Free Tax Filing Assistance

Posted on Monday, February 14, 2022 07:00 AM

With tax season around the corner, the Community Volunteer Income Tax Program is preparing to support residents with tax filing. The program provides over the phone tax filing for Stony Plain and Parkland County residents with modest income and simple tax situations, and further hosts educational sessions on a variety of tax and benefits topics.

Governance and Priorities Meeting Highlights for February 7, 2022

Posted on Tuesday, February 08, 2022 08:45 AM

Edmonton Metropolitan Board Joins Council for a Presentation on a Unified Region

Council was joined by representatives from the Edmonton Metropolitan Region Board (EMRB) for a presentation outlining the board’s focus areas and development goals. The EMRB represents 13 municipalities in the Edmonton Metropolitan Region, the second fastest growing metropolitan region in Canada.
